Top Hotel In Tinsukia | Reviews & Ratings | vimarsana.com
Hotel in tinsukia in India - 786125/ near tinsukia
Hotel in tinsukia in India - 786145/ near tinsukia
Hotel in tinsukia in India - 786125/ near tinsukia
Hotel in tinsukia in India - 886656/ near tinsukia
Hotel in tinsukia in India - 786125/ near tinsukia
Hotel in tinsukia in India - 786187/ near tinsukia
Hotel in tinsukia in India - 786171/ near tinsukia
Hotel in tinsukia in India - 786125/ near tinsukia